How do I find out what DNS server I am using?

To view the DNS being used by Windows, run a Command Prompt, and type “ipconfig /all” followed by Enter. “DNS Servers” will be listed in the information displayed.

How do I find my DNS in RHEL?

Procedure to change DNS ip address in RHEL

  1. Edit the /etc/resolv.conf file with an editor, such as nano or vim in RHEL: sudo vim /etc/resolv.conf.
  2. Set the name servers (DNS IP) that you want to use on RHEL : nameserver 192.168.2.254.
  3. Save and close the file in RHEL.
  4. Test new settings.

How do I find DNS in Linux?

To determine what DNS servers are being used, you simply need to view the contents of the “/etc/resolv. conf” file. This can be done via a graphical editing tool such as gedit, or can easily be viewed from the command line with a simple “cat” of the file, to show the contents.

Does Smart DNS hide your IP?

The biggest differences between a smart DNS and VPN solutions are that a smart DNS doesn’t encrypt your connection or hide your IP. This makes it less powerful when it comes to unblocking websites online.

How do I list all DNS records nslookup?

For Windows:

  1. Launch Windows Command Prompt by navigating to Start > Command Prompt or via Run > CMD.
  2. Type NSLOOKUP and hit Enter.
  3. Set the DNS Record type you wish to lookup by typing set type=## where ## is the record type, then hit Enter.
  4. Now enter the domain name you wish to query then hit Enter..

How do I find the DNS server name in Linux?

To check the current nameservers (DNS) for any domain name from a Linux or Unix/macOS command line:

  1. Open the Terminal application.
  2. Type host -t ns domain-name-com-here to print the current DNS servers of a domain.
  3. Another options is to run dig ns your-domain-name command.

What is DNS server for VPN?

DNS (Domain Name System) allows users to get access to resources by name rather than IP address. When a user attempts to get access to a device by a name, such as www.example.net, the client computer sends a request to its configured DNS server, which returns the IP address associated with that device name.
